Google is putting artificial intelligence at the centre of its latest generation of consumer devices.
At its Made by Google 2026 event, the technology giant unveiled the Pixel 11 smartphone family alongside the Pixel Watch 5 and Pixel Tag.
However, the hardware was not the only focus.
Google used the event to demonstrate how its Gemini artificial intelligence technology can become deeply integrated into everyday devices.
The move reflects a major shift taking place across the smartphone industry.
Manufacturers are increasingly competing not only on cameras, processors and display technology but also on artificial intelligence.

The Pixel 11 Generation
Google’s latest Pixel range includes the Pixel 11, Pixel 11 Pro and Pixel 11 Pro XL.
The company has also introduced a new foldable model.
The new devices combine Google’s hardware with its software and artificial intelligence systems.
Google is also continuing to develop its Pixel Watch range.
The Pixel Watch 5 forms part of the company’s broader strategy to build an ecosystem in which phones, watches and other devices work together.
The Pixel Tag also expands Google’s hardware portfolio into the tracking-device market.
AI Is Becoming a Hardware Feature
One of the most important developments is the increasing integration of AI into hardware.
In the past, artificial intelligence was often presented as an online service.
Users would visit a website or open an application to interact with an AI system.
That model is changing.
Technology companies are now designing hardware specifically around AI capabilities.
This could eventually allow more AI processing to take place directly on devices.
That could improve response times and potentially reduce dependence on cloud servers for certain tasks.

Privacy Remains Important
However, the growth of AI-powered personal devices also raises questions about privacy.
AI assistants may need access to personal information to provide useful responses.
That creates an important responsibility for technology companies.
Consumers need to understand what information their devices collect, where that information is processed and how it is protected.
As AI becomes more deeply integrated into smartphones, privacy and security will therefore become just as important as performance.
